A group of experts headed by Ulugbek Egamov visited Latvia on a business trip

A group of experts led by Ulugbek Egamov, the first deputy director of the Agency for the Development of the Pharmaceutical Network, visited the Republic of Latvia on September 12-14 this year.

A group of agency experts and a delegation of about ten industry enterprises took part in the international trade mission organized under the brand "Made in Uzbekistan" in Riga under the Ministry of Investments and Foreign Trade initiative of the Republic of Uzbekistan.

On September 12, a presentation of the first deputy director of the Agency on the topic "Investment attractiveness of the pharmaceutical industry in the Republic of Uzbekistan" was held as part of the business forum. He talked about the benefits given to new investors in the pharmaceutical-free economic zones of our country and the favorable conditions created for the development of their activities. In particular, the "Tashkent Pharma Park" innovative scientific-production pharmaceutical cluster project aroused great interest among the participants.

During the B2B negotiations, Uzbek companies had the opportunity to get acquainted with the main features of the Latvian market, the experience of cooperation, delivery of local products from various industries to the Baltic and EU countries, and directions of cooperation. Also, negotiations were held with the representatives of "Lotos Pharma," "PharmaSwiss Latvia, SIA" and "Merck & Co" enterprises of the Republic of Latvia.

The negotiations yielded several positive results. In particular:
The company "Fazo Lux" LLC presented preliminary documents, considering the existence of a European certificate to export medical products. After registration in the Republic of Latvia, officials agreed to sign the first export contract worth 500,000 US dollars.

"Dentafill plus" LLC negotiated with Swedish businessmen on the issue of introducing products to the Lithuanian market and selling products to the demands of Sweden and neighboring republics.

On September 13, the delegation visited the "Grindeks" JSC, one of the largest pharmaceutical companies of the Republic of Latvia, which currently imports about 20 medicines to Uzbekistan. During the visit, officials discussed the issues of the localization of drugs in our republic.

During the negotiations between "Olainfarm" JSC and "Aziya Immunopreparat" LLC, experts proposed a draft cooperation agreement to produce and export immunobiological bacteriophage drugs in our country.

On September 14, members of the delegation visited the State Agency of Medicines of the Republic of Latvia.

During the meeting, representatives discussed the issues of expanding the circulation of pharmaceutical products and increasing the terminology between the countries in Latvia's trade and economic sphere. Furthermore, they proposed simplifying the registration of pharmaceutical products between countries.

At the end of the negotiations, parties agreed that the list of drugs and medical products produced by local enterprises of Uzbekistan and with high export potential would be delivered to the Latvian side through the diplomatic channels of the Republic of Uzbekistan in Latvia.

The State Agency of Medicines of the Republic of Latvia and the State Center for Expertise and Standardization of Medicines, Medical Products, and Equipment of Uzbekistan agreed to establish a permanent exchange of information on the review of pharmaceutical products submitted for registration by the two states enterprises.
